Title: Exploring the Challenges and Solutions of Blockchain Scalability
Introduction:
Blockchain technology has revolutionized the way we think about transactions, data storage, and security. However, one of the biggest challenges facing blockchain networks today is scalability. As more users and transactions are added to the network, the strain on the system becomes increasingly apparent. In this article, we will explore the challenges of blockchain scalability and the solutions that are being developed to address them.
The Challenge of Blockchain Scalability:
Blockchain networks, such as Bitcoin and Ethereum, operate on a decentralized system of nodes that work together to validate and record transactions. However, as the number of users and transactions on the network increases, the time it takes to process each transaction also increases. This can lead to slow transaction speeds, high fees, and congestion on the network.
One of the main reasons for this scalability issue is the limited block size of blockchain networks. Each block on the blockchain has a maximum size limit, which means that only a certain number of transactions can be included in each block. As more transactions are added to the network, the blocks become full, causing delays in processing transactions.
Solutions to Blockchain Scalability:
Several solutions are being developed to address the scalability issues facing blockchain networks. One of the most popular solutions is the implementation of off-chain scaling solutions, such as the Lightning Network for Bitcoin and the Raiden Network for Ethereum. These solutions allow for faster and cheaper transactions by moving some transactions off-chain and settling them later on the main blockchain.
Another solution to blockchain scalability is the implementation of sharding. Sharding involves splitting the blockchain network into smaller, more manageable pieces called shards. Each shard is responsible for processing a subset of transactions, which helps to increase the overall transaction throughput of the network.
Conclusion:
Blockchain scalability is a pressing issue that must be addressed in order for blockchain technology to reach its full potential. By implementing off-chain scaling solutions, such as the Lightning Network and the Raiden Network, and exploring sharding as a way to increase transaction throughput, blockchain networks can become faster, more efficient, and more scalable. As the technology continues to evolve, we can expect to see even more innovative solutions to the challenges of blockchain scalability.